BROOKS v. SOUTHAMPTON HOSP.


200 A.D.2d 530 (1994)

606 N.Y.S.2d 675

Germaine Brooks, Appellant, v. Southampton Hospital et al.,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

January 25, 1994


No undue burden would be imposed on defendant White in producing the office notes at the expert's office instead of the office of White's counsel. It is not disputed that the document is only 2 pages and that the expert's office is located only a few blocks from White's counsel's office. Moreover, the expert's assertion of the necessity of using non-transportable testing equipment in his office has not been refuted.
